Your Team**:

- Join the Maintenance Planning team at Flair as a Technical Records Coordinator, where precision and organization are essential to supporting safe and efficient aircraft operations. Reporting to the Maintenance Planning Supervisor, you will be responsible for maintaining and managing the technical library, including aircraft manuals, maintenance publications, and other critical documentation. In this role, you will ensure all technical records are accurately organized, current, and compliant with regulatory standards, playing a key part in supporting maintenance and operational teams. You’ll work independently in a hangar, storeroom, or office environment and may occasionally travel to support documentation needs at other locations. Physical tasks may include prolonged standing, reaching, bending, and climbing, all performed with a strong focus on safety and detail.
- This position is based on-site at our Calgary, AB (YYC) office.

**
A Day in the Life**:

- As a Technical Records Coordinator, you will:

- Maintain a comprehensive and up-to-date online technical library of aircraft and maintenance documentation for use by company personnel and approved vendors
- Track and manage all technical publications using the library database, implementing effective systems for inventory control and version management
- Ensure timely distribution of technical manuals, publications, and revisions across the organization to support operational accuracy and compliance.
- Coordinate the distribution, collection, assembly, and replacement of all maintenance-related manuals and technical documents.
- Monitor and update all company manuals, aircraft technical publications, STC provider/manufacturer manuals, and service bulletins to ensure revision compliance.
- Manage user access to MyBoeingFleet and other OEM portals for authorized company employees.
- Assist in the maintenance and organization of aircraft technical records in accordance with regulatory requirements and company standards.
- Perform spot checks and audits of completed log pages, work packages, and work cards, with a focus on Service Bulletin (SB) and Airworthiness Directive (AD) compliance.
- Maintain accurate records of Minimum Equipment List (MEL) extension activity and ensure documentation is retained per regulatory guidelines.
- Manage the records inventory using an Access database, ensuring accuracy and accessibility.
- Organize, compile, and prepare records for secure transfer to off-site storage facilities.
- Coordinate storage and retrieval of records with off-site vendors, maintaining proper documentation and tracking.
- Perform additional duties as assigned by the Maintenance Planning Supervisor to support department needs.-
